Description
This is a barn located to the north of Mark Cottage, dating from the 17th century and restored in the 19th century. It features a timber frame, with brick cladding on the front below and weatherboarding above and at the rear. The roof is plain tiled. The barn consists of five framed bays and has central opposing waggon doors. Inside, there is a queen-strut clasped-purlin roof and diagonal wall bracing. The barn is included for its group value.
